How do I know when to replace the belt?
Squealing on start-up, cracking, glazing, fraying, or chunks missing from the ribs are common signs a serpentine belt may need replacing.
Should I inspect anything else when replacing it?
Yes—inspect the tensioner and pulleys, since they share the same drive path. A worn tensioner can shorten a new belt's life.
